Overview of the Products
The ALLSET 700 Professional Electric Drum Set is priced at $383.99, while the Electric Drumsticks Air Drum Sticks 4rd Gen. come in at a significantly lower price of $99.00. This price difference highlights a stark contrast in what each product offers in terms of features and functionality. The ALLSET drum set is designed for serious drummers seeking a comprehensive electronic drum kit experience, while the Electric Drumsticks serve as a portable and quieter alternative for casual users or those with limited space.
Target Audience
The ALLSET 700 is tailored for dedicated drummers and musicians who are looking for an immersive and realistic drumming experience. It includes a complete set of components, making it suitable for both practice and performance. In contrast, the Electric Drumsticks are aimed at beginners or casual drummers, including kids and adults who want to practice drumming without the bulk of a traditional drum set. With its portability and ease of use, the Electric Drumsticks cater to those who may need a simple, on-the-go solution.
Features and Functionality
The ALLSET 700 boasts a wide array of features, including 10" dual zone snare pads, 30 different kits, and over 600 BFD sounds, making it an incredibly versatile choice for drummers. The Electric Drumsticks, on the other hand, come with 8 distinct sounds and offer Bluetooth connectivity for jamming along with music. While the ALLSET focuses on providing a realistic drumming experience, the Electric Drumsticks offer convenience and simplicity, highlighting the key differences in their intended use.
Sound Quality
Sound quality is a major differentiator between these two products. The ALLSET 700 features advanced mesh drum pads that provide a closer feel to acoustic drums, allowing for a more authentic performance. Its built-in BFD sounds enhance the overall sound experience, enabling users to connect to a PC or Mac for additional sound libraries. Conversely, the Electric Drumsticks deliver 8 high-quality sounds, though they may not match the depth and realism of the ALLSET 700. This makes the ALLSET preferable for serious musicians, while the Electric Drumsticks are adequate for casual play.
Portability
When it comes to portability, the Electric Drumsticks excel with their lightweight and compact design, making them easy to carry and use anywhere. They require minimal setup—just a speaker or headphones—and can be played in various environments. The ALLSET 700, however, is a full-fledged drum kit that requires more space and setup time, making it less convenient for mobile use. If portability is a priority, the Electric Drumsticks are clearly the better option.
Price Comparison
At $383.99, the ALLSET 700 is significantly more expensive than the Electric Drumsticks, which are priced at just $99.00. This represents a difference of about 74%, making the drumsticks a much more budget-friendly option. While the higher price of the ALLSET 700 reflects its advanced features and capabilities, the Electric Drumsticks provide an entry-level alternative that is accessible for those not ready to invest in a full drum kit.
